from __future__ import annotations
from dataclasses import dataclass
from src.core.logger import logger
from src.services.auth.oauth.base import OAuthProviderBase
@dataclass(frozen=True)
class SupportedOAuthType:
provider_type: str
display_name: str
# 默认端点(用于前端 placeholder 展示)
default_authorization_url: str
default_token_url: str
default_userinfo_url: str
default_scopes: tuple[str, ...]
class OAuthProviderRegistry:
"""Provider 注册表(支持延迟 discover"""
def __init__(self) -> None:
self._providers: dict[str, OAuthProviderBase] = {}
self._discovered: bool = False
def discover_providers(self) -> None:
"""发现并注册 providers幂等"""
if self._discovered:
return
self._discovered = True
# 1) 内置 providersv1至少保证 linuxdo 可用)
try:
from src.services.auth.oauth.providers.linuxdo import LinuxDoOAuthProvider
self.register(LinuxDoOAuthProvider())
except Exception as exc:
logger.warning("OAuth 内置 provider 加载失败: {}", exc)
# 2) entry_points 插件(可选)
try:
from importlib.metadata import entry_points
eps = entry_points()
# Python 3.10+ 支持 select旧接口返回 dict
if hasattr(eps, "select"):
candidates = list(eps.select(group="aether.oauth_providers")) # type: ignore[attr-defined]
else:
candidates = list(eps.get("aether.oauth_providers", [])) # type: ignore[call-arg]
for ep in candidates:
try:
loaded = ep.load()
provider = loaded() if isinstance(loaded, type) else loaded
if not isinstance(provider, OAuthProviderBase):
logger.warning(
"OAuth provider entry_point 无效: {} (type={})", ep.name, type(provider)
)
continue
self.register(provider)
except Exception as e:
logger.warning("OAuth provider entry_point 加载失败: {}: {}", ep.name, e)
except Exception as exc:
# entry_points 不可用不影响主流程
logger.debug("OAuth entry_points discover skipped: {}", exc)
def register(self, provider: OAuthProviderBase) -> None:
self._providers[provider.provider_type] = provider
def get_provider(self, provider_type: str) -> OAuthProviderBase | None:
return self._providers.get(provider_type)
def get_supported_types(self) -> list[SupportedOAuthType]:
return [
SupportedOAuthType(
provider_type=p.provider_type,
display_name=p.display_name,
default_authorization_url=p.authorization_url,
default_token_url=p.token_url,
default_userinfo_url=p.userinfo_url,
default_scopes=p.default_scopes,
)
for p in sorted(self._providers.values(), key=lambda x: x.provider_type)
]
_registry: OAuthProviderRegistry | None = None
def get_oauth_provider_registry() -> OAuthProviderRegistry:
global _registry
if _registry is None:
_registry = OAuthProviderRegistry()
return _registry
